A design document is a tool used within the context of SFS development. It is largely used as an internal tool for communicating detailed ideas about the formal structure and function of potential changes to the SFS software and website. It is used at various stages in the development process. Initially it can be used to set out proposed ideas and later as a guide of work yet to be done.

Creating a new Design Document

To create a new Design Document use the 'Design Document' issue type in Jira. You must at minimum provide some text in "Background".

Exporting a Jira Design Document

Jira design documents can be exported for review outside the web by using the views option.
